Equity is not uniform. Every community has different needs. Equitable Giving Circle was created to address this fact. So often, giving between the nonprofit community and those who need support is transactional. The processes and proof can sometimes feel prohibitive and take too much time. We are a community of people committed to creating peer-led, community-funded, transformational change. Our work aims to build immediate and increased equity throughout Portland’s BIPOC (Black, Indigenous, and People of Color) communities through a combination of fund development and network building opportunities that center economic equity.
We have three branches of our work: food justice, housing justice, and wellness work. Ongoing we weekly serve 325+ BIPOC families with food we buy from Black and Brown Farmers.
